The Birth of Castiel Merch: From Screen to Store
The first wave of Castiel merchandise appeared shortly after the angel’s debut in season four. Small‑batch prints of his signature winged pose were sold at conventions, and the items sold out within hours. This rapid sell‑through signaled a strong, untapped appetite among the *Supernatural* fandom. Over the next few seasons, official licensing deals expanded the range to include hoodies, limited‑edition art prints, and even collectible figurines. Each new release seemed to capture a fresh aspect of the character—whether it was his evolving moral compass or his often‑humorous one‑liners.
What set Castiel Merch apart from generic show memorabilia was its authenticity. Production teams consulted directly with Misha Collins, ensuring that designs stayed true to the angel’s personality. This collaboration helped create items that felt personal rather than mass‑produced, turning each piece into a badge of loyalty for fans who felt a deep connection to the on‑screen angel.
How Misha Collins’ Personality Shapes the Merchandise
Misha Collins is known for his generosity, humor, and dedication to fan interaction. He regularly engages with followers on social media, shares behind‑the‑scenes anecdotes, and even surprises fans with spontaneous giveaways. These gestures have a direct ripple effect on the popularity of Castiel Merch. When Misha posts a photo wearing a new hoodie or using a special coffee mug, the item instantly becomes coveted, and fans rush to replicate that experience.
Beyond the occasional selfie, Collins often collaborates on design concepts. He has co‑created limited‑edition enamel pins featuring his beloved “Chicken” gag and even contributed text for a line of humorous “Angel” greeting cards. By embedding his own wit and preferences into the products, Misha gives fans a sense of co‑ownership—like they’re part of the creative process rather than just consumers.
Fan Community and the Collectors’ Culture
The Castiel Merch market thrives on a tight‑knit community that shares unboxing videos, styling tips, and swap meets at fan conventions. Online forums are flooded with discussions comparing the quality of different prints, hunting down rare variants, and showcasing custom alterations. This collective enthusiasm fuels a secondary market where limited‑edition items can fetch premium prices.
Collectors often treat each piece as a milestone in the character’s journey. A fan might keep the first Castiel T‑shirt they bought at a 2010 convention alongside a 2022 anniversary art print, creating a personal timeline of the series’ evolution. This ritualistic aspect transforms ordinary merchandise into treasured keepsakes, reinforcing the bond between the audience and the angelic figure.
